加入收藏 | 设为首页 | 会员中心 | 我要投稿 源码门户网 (https://www.92codes.com/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

Mysql怎么查看、创建以及更换数据库和表

发布时间:2022-01-19 03:21:46 所属栏目:MySql教程 来源:互联网
导读:本篇内容介绍了Mysql怎么查看、创建以及更改数据库和表的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成! 修改mysql数据库密码 方法一: 使用phpmyadm
         本篇内容介绍了“Mysql怎么查看、创建以及更改数据库和表”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!
 
         修改mysql数据库密码
 
方法一:
 
使用phpmyadmin,直接修改Mysql库的user 表。或者使用Navicat for Mysql 直接修改连接属性。
  
方法二:使用mysqladmin
 
#cmd,运行DOS,cd到mysql的bin文件夹,然后执行如下
D:Mysqlbin>mysqladmin -u root -p password newPwd
#Enter password:(在此输入原密码)
#newPwd指的是新密码
然后打开mysql 直接输入新密码即可
格式:mysqladmin -u用户名 -p旧密码 password 新密码。
  
创建数据库
 
mysql> CREATE DATABASE 库名;
mysql> USE 库名;
mysql> CREATE TABLE 表名 (字段名 VARCHAR(20), 字段名 CHAR(1));
#创建表 use demo; create table pet(
        name varchar(20),        #名字
        owner varchar(20),       #主人
        species varchar(20),     #种类
        sex char(1),             #性别
        birth date,              #出生日期
        death date               #死亡日期
)
为了验证你的表是按你期望的方式创建,使用一个DESCRIBE语句:
  
#创建customer表: create table customers(
    id int not null auto_increment,
    name char(20) not null,
    address char(50) null,
    city char(50) null,
    age int not null,
    love char(50) not null default 'No habbit', primary key(id)
)engine=InnoDB; #SELECT last_insert_id();这个函数可以获得返回最后一个auto_increment值. #默认值:default 'No habbit', #引擎类型,多为engine = InnoDB,如果省略了engine=语句,则使用默认的引擎(MyISAM)
 更改表结构:
 
#增加一列 alter table pet add des char(100) null;
#删除 alter table pet drop column des;
重命名表:
 
#重命名表
rename table pet to animals;

(编辑:源码门户网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!